Dr. Manduhu Manduhu is a researcher at the forefront of aerial robotics and autonomous navigation, with a specific focus on path planning for robotic surveillance and monitoring systems. His work addresses critical challenges in deploying un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) in complex, real-world environments, particularly under high-wind scenarios where stability and efficiency are paramount. In his highly cited 2023 paper, "CDDQN based efficient path planning for Aerial surveillance in high wind scenarios," Dr. Manduhu introduced a novel deep reinforcement learning approach that significantly improves the adaptability and energy efficiency of drones operating in adverse weather. This contribution is vital for military, industrial, and infrastructure applications—including ports and airports—where reliable aerial monitoring is essential.
